Navigating the Mortgage Maze: A Guide for First-Time Buyers
Buying your first home is an exciting time, but the mortgage process can feel overwhelming. Don't worry, you're not alone! Many first-time buyers find themselves bogged down in a maze of technicalities.
To make this journey smoother, consider some key steps to help you navigate the mortgage process.
First, it's crucial to figure out your budget. Figure out how much you can realistically pay each month for a mortgage payment. Think about all your expenses, not just the monthly payment.
Next, begin shopping around for mortgage lenders. Compare interest rates, loan terms, and lender fees to find the best deal for you.
Don't be afraid to request questions and compare different options before making a decision.
Once you've selected a lender, you'll need to compile the necessary documentation. This usually includes your income verification, credit report, and tax returns.
Be organized these documents to streamline the application process.
Finally, remember that perseverance is key. The mortgage process can take some time, but by being informed and prepared, you can successfully navigate this important milestone.
